As I sat on the serene waters, amongst the illuminating stars, I wondered how anything this magnificent could present itself, on this peaceful night. Life takes us on a journey every day of our lives, and yet, in the midst of life, are silent waters and we are given a glimpse of the inevitable beauty of our maker’s hand.
As we go through life, we see all that is available, even in the silent waters and the quiet of night. The stars shine in the night for our thoughts, imagination and dare to take us on the next adventure.
